"The Tell" by psychologist Matthew Hertenstein explores how our intuition and ability to observe subtle cues can help us make better predictions about various aspects of life, from personal relationships to corporate success. Drawing on research in psychology and brain science, the book offers insights into honing our observational skills to interpret facial and bodily signals accurately. It demonstrates the surprising power of human perception in understanding the world around us, encouraging readers to develop their noticing abilities.
